Question: What is ATSAME70Q21A-CNT?
Answer: ATSAME70Q21A-CNT is a microcontroller from Microchip's SAM E70 series, designed for embedded applications.
Question: What are the key features of ATSAME70Q21A-CNT?
Answer: Some key features include a 300 MHz ARM Cortex-M7 processor, 2MB flash memory, 384KB SRAM, multiple communication interfaces, and advanced peripherals.
Question: What are the typical applications of ATSAME70Q21A-CNT?
Answer: ATSAME70Q21A-CNT is commonly used in industrial automation, IoT devices, motor control systems, smart energy management, and other embedded applications.
Question: How can I program ATSAME70Q21A-CNT?
Answer: You can program ATSAME70Q21A-CNT using various development tools such as Atmel Studio, MPLAB X IDE, or third-party IDEs that support ARM Cortex-M processors.
Question: Does ATSAME70Q21A-CNT support real-time operating systems (RTOS)?
Answer: Yes, ATSAME70Q21A-CNT is compatible with popular RTOS like FreeRTOS, Micrium µC/OS, and embOS, allowing you to build complex multitasking applications.
Question: Can I connect external sensors or peripherals to ATSAME70Q21A-CNT?
Answer: Absolutely! ATSAME70Q21A-CNT offers a wide range of communication interfaces such as UART, SPI, I2C, USB, Ethernet, and CAN, allowing easy integration with external devices.
